Acharya Institute of Technology MCA Eligibility and Highlights 2025
Acharya Institute of Technology MCA is offered in Full Time mode. Further, this course is offered in PG level. The eligibility criteria required by the Acharya Institute of Technology to get admissions into MCA require candidates to complete KMAT and Karnataka PGCET with decent scores.
For admission confirmation, candidates are required to pay a certain amount of Acharya Institute of Technology MCA fee. Candidates can pay this fee through online payment mode, via DD, offline or other modes as prescribed by the college.

AIT MCAAcharya Institute of Technology MCA Seats 2025
Acharya Institute of Technology has a total intake of 120 students for its MCA. Acharya Institute of Technology seats are allocated to students based on their performance in the selection round. For more information, candidates can refer to the following table:
| Courses | Seats |
|---|---|
| Master of Computer Applications (MCA) | 120 |
